[Tu-P2-G-03 (Invited)]Direct Bandgap SiGe Quantum Dots Realized in Nanowires
〇Denny Lamon1, Marvin Marco Jansen1, Marcel A Verheijen2,1, Erik P.A.M. Bakkers1 (1. Eindhoven University of Technology (Netherlands), 2. Eurofins Materials Science (Netherlands))
SiGe in the hexagonal crystal phase has been engineered into the first 0D quantum dots with sub-5 nm sharp interfaces, tunable geometry, and fully defect-free heterostructures, unlocking a versatile new platform for advanced quantum and photonic applications.
